Curtis E. Dunn's Obituary
Curtis E. Dunn, 83, of North Fort Myers passed away on January 5, 2013. Born in Alabama, Curtis moved to Florida in 1947. He was a Korean War veteran, serving in the Navy on the U.S.S. Worchester. The railroad was his career, but his life-long passion was music. He started playing country music in a small Baptist Church in Hernando. He landed a job playing music on WINK-TV during the mid 50?ÇÖs on a program called Reeves and Sons Town & Country Show. He is listed in the Florida Country Music Association?ÇÖs Hall of Fame and is a multiple award winning member.
